    [aarch64] add target feature outline-atomics
    
    Enable outline-atomics by default as enabled in clang by the following commit
    https://reviews.llvm.org/rGc5e7e649d537067dec7111f3de1430d0fc8a4d11
    
    Performance improves by several orders of magnitude when using the LSE instructions
    instead of the ARMv8.0 compatible load/store exclusive instructions.
    
    Tested on Graviton2 aarch64-linux with
    x.py build && x.py install && x.py test

    implement advance_(back_)_by on more iterators
    
    Add more efficient, non-default implementations for `feature(iter_advance_by)` (rust-lang#77404) on more iterators and adapters.
    
    This PR only contains implementations where skipping over items doesn't elide any observable side-effects such as user-provided closures or `clone()` functions. I'll put those in a separate PR.

    Fix an ICE caused by type mismatch errors being ignored
    
    This PR fixes rust-lang#87771. It turns out that the check on `compiler/rustc_typeck/src/check/demand.rs:148` leads to the ICE. I removed it because the early return in [`check_expr_assign`](https://github.com/theo-lw/rust/blob/dec7fc3ced5bc3c18d0e5d29921d087f93189cb8/compiler/rustc_typeck/src/check/expr.rs#L928) already prevents unnecessary error messages from the call to `check_expr_coercable_to_type`.

    VecDeque: improve performance for From<[T; N]>
    
    Create `VecDeque` directly from the array instead of inserting items one-by-one.
    
    Benchmark
    ```
    ./x.py bench library/alloc --test-args vec_deque::bench_from_array_1000
    ```
    
    * Before
    ```
    test vec_deque::bench_from_array_1000                    ... bench:       3,991 ns/iter (+/- 717)
    ```
    
    * After
    ```
    test vec_deque::bench_from_array_1000                    ... bench:         268 ns/iter (+/- 37)
    ```

    Improve wording of `map_or_else` docs
    
    Changes doc text to refer to the "default" parameter as the "default"
    function.
    
    Previously, the doc text referred to the "f" parameter as the "default" function; and the "default" parameter as the "fallback" function.

    Fix ICE with buffered lint referring to AST node deleted by everybody_loops
    
    Fixes rust-lang#87308. Note the following comment:
    https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/blob/08759c691e2e9799a3c6780ffdf910240ebd4a6b/compiler/rustc_lint/src/early.rs#L415-L417
    
    As it turns out, this is not _always_ a bug, because `-Zunpretty=everybody_loops` causes a lot of AST nodes to be deleted, and thus some buffered lints will refer to non-existent node ids. To fix this, my changes simply ignore buffered lints if `-Zunpretty=everybody_loops` is enabled, which, from my understanding, shouldn't be a big issue because it only affects pretty-printing. Of course, a more elegant solution would only ignore buffered lints that actually point at deleted node ids, but I haven't figured out an easy way of achieving this.
    
    For the concrete example in rust-lang#87308, the buffered lint is created [here](https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/blob/08759c691e2e9799a3c6780ffdf910240ebd4a6b/compiler/rustc_expand/src/mbe/macro_rules.rs#L145-L151) with the `lint_node_id` from [here](https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/blob/08759c691e2e9799a3c6780ffdf910240ebd4a6b/compiler/rustc_expand/src/mbe/macro_rules.rs#L319), i.e. it points at the macro _expansion_, which then gets deleted by `ReplaceBodyWithLoop` [here](https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/blob/08759c691e2e9799a3c6780ffdf910240ebd4a6b/compiler/rustc_interface/src/passes.rs#L377).
